Movable furniture has become an essential element in contemporary interior design, especially as living spaces continue to evolve. With urbanization accelerating and homes becoming smaller, people are seeking smarter ways to maximize every square foot. Movable furniture offers a practical and stylish solution, allowing homeowners to adapt their environment to different needs throughout the day. One of the most significant advantages of movable furniture is its ability to transform a space instantly. A living room can become a workspace, a dining area, or even a guest room with just a few adjustments. Items such as foldable tables, modular sofas, and rolling storage units allow users to reconfigure their rooms without heavy lifting or complicated installations. This adaptability is especially valuable for people living in apartments or shared spaces, where multifunctionality is key to comfort and convenience.
Another important aspect of movable furniture is its contribution to efficient space management. Traditional furniture often occupies a fixed position, limiting how a room can be used. In contrast, movable pieces encourage creativity and experimentation. For example, a mobile kitchen island can serve as a food preparation area, a dining table, or a bar for entertaining guests. Similarly, a modular shelving system can be rearranged to accommodate new items or to create visual separation between different zones in an open-plan layout. These flexible solutions help homeowners make the most of limited space while maintaining a clean and organized environment.
Movable furniture also supports a more sustainable lifestyle. Because these pieces are designed to adapt to changing needs, they tend to have a longer lifespan than traditional furniture. Instead of replacing items when moving to a new home or rearranging a room, users can simply reconfigure what they already have. This reduces waste and encourages more mindful consumption. Additionally, many manufacturers are now using eco-friendly materials and production methods, further enhancing the sustainability of movable furniture.
Aesthetic versatility is another reason for the growing popularity of movable furniture. Designers are creating pieces that are not only functional but also visually appealing. Sleek lines, neutral colors, and minimalist forms allow these items to blend seamlessly with various interior styles. Whether someone prefers a modern, industrial, or Scandinavian look, there are movable furniture options that complement their taste. This design flexibility empowers individuals to express their personality while maintaining a practical and adaptable home environment.
Technology has also played a role in the evolution of movable furniture. Innovations such as lightweight materials, smooth-rolling casters, and easy-lock mechanisms make it simpler than ever to move and adjust furniture. Some advanced designs even incorporate smart features, such as height-adjustable desks or modular units that can be controlled through mobile apps. These technological enhancements further improve usability and convenience, making movable furniture an attractive choice for tech-savvy consumers.
Ultimately, movable furniture represents a shift toward more dynamic and user-centered living spaces. It encourages people to think differently about how they use their homes and empowers them to create environments that support their lifestyle. Whether for small apartments, flexible offices, or multifunctional family rooms, movable furniture offers endless possibilities for customization and comfort. As the demand for adaptable living solutions continues to grow, movable furniture will undoubtedly remain a key trend in interior design.
